84 What is a dispute

(1) There is a dispute relating to a scheme in any of the following circumstances:

(a) the body corporate, or a unit owner, unit occupier or mortgagee of a unit, claims there is, or has been, a contravention of this Act by a person in relation to the scheme;

(b) a unit owner claims to have been wrongfully treated by:

(i) the body corporate or committee, or a delegate of the body corporate or committee; or

(ii) another unit owner or a unit occupier;

(c) a unit owner claims a decision of the body corporate or committee, or a delegate of the body corporate or committee, is unreasonable, oppressive or unjust;

(ca) a unit owner claims the body corporate or committee, or a delegate of the body corporate or committee, has failed or unreasonably refused to perform a function imposed, or to exercise a power conferred, on the body corporate or committee under this Act or the management module of the scheme;

(cb) a dispute has arisen between a body corporate and the body corporate manager in relation to the administrative services provided by the manager in accordance with the manager's engagement;

(cc) a body corporate claims the body corporate manager has contravened the code of conduct that applies to the manager's engagement;

(d) a dispute relating to a unit or the common property has arisen:

(i) between a unit owner and the body corporate or committee; or

(ii) between

2 or more unit owners;

(e) other circumstances prescribed by regulation.

(2) However, a matter that would otherwise be a dispute under subsection (1) is not a dispute if it relates to a termination of a scheme under the

Termination of Units Plans and Unit Title

Schemes Act 2014.
